Wolf Seeburg has a kick-ass little transmitter that operates on cable Ch. 57 which he calls his "spy-transmitter."  It's tiny (about 1" square minus the antenna) and blasts through anything else on the market.  It IS NOT tunable, but seems to work anywhere I tried it.  Be certain to get the one able to take 30VDC (as opposed to 12VDC).  Iaccidentally put mine on a Panavision and smoked it.  It is not repairable being potted in epoxy.  About $500 I think.

Be careful with 2.4 GHz above 1 watt, continuous duty (as in an analog video transmitter).

Federal limits are 4 watts EIRP for the unlicensed stuff, which means the combination of radiated power produced collectively by the transmitter and antenna system, minus any losses in the system. 4w is approaching the power output of commercial ENG transmitters, which some say produce dangerous/harmful levels of microwave radiation.

I don't wear my tinfoil hat much these days, but I'd keep the antenna away from my/your head just the same!

All right.  Don't laugh.  But, I found some el-cheapo transmitters on eBay that I'm quite pleased with.

They're cheaper than dirt and perform surprisingly well.  They have four tranmit/receive channels and cost less than thirty bucks including shipping and insurance.  They operate on 9-12 volts.  If you're in a situation where you can't use the included AC adapter, you can even tape a 9 volt battery to the top and power it from that.  However I haven't tried them long term on higher voltages such as 14+V. from lithiums.

When I need to be more mobile, I can give a transmitter (or several) to video assist and get my cart signal(s) from there.

They're not great for a really long range and I sometimes get a bit of dropout on set, but it still gives me what I need as far as helping the boom op find frame lines, etc.  I have several and for multiple camera shoots can easily have all the feeds wireless to the cart.

I have a 2,4GHz system whith 250mW power and has very bad reception. If somebody walk between antenas or move transmiter ( when is put on steadicam) lose signal. This is problems whith high frequency - works great whith free line of view between antenas or whith static transmiter and receiver.

I think 900  MHz works better but I don`t  saw  on work any of that. Anybody have one 900MHZ video transmitter to tell us if is better than 2,4 GHz?

If you can solder at all, it couldn't be much easier. 

Purchase a 9v. battery snap-on connector:

http://www.radioshack.com/product/index.jsp?productId=2062219&cp=2032058&f=Taxonomy%2FRSK%2F2032058&categoryId=2032058&kwCatId=2032058&kw=battery+snap&parentPage=search

(A package of 5 is only $1.99.)

Also purchase a coaxial DC power plug:

http://www.radioshack.com/product/index.jsp?productId=2103614&cp=2032058.2032231.2032284&parentPage=family

(This is just a sample of what the connector looks like, this may not be the correct size. I don't know the size off-hand, so just take one of the units with you to R.S. and find a connector that fits properly.) 

Then, solder the red lead from the snap-on connector to the center lead of the barrel connector and the black lead to the sleeve.  (Don't forget to put the screw-on handle portion over the wires before you solder them so you can screw the handle into place when you're done.  Make sure the wires don't short together when you screw on the handle.)

It's one of the easiest solder jobs you could do.
